FINAL WHISTLE: Out, end, over! FC Bayern are German champions, Borussia Dortmund lose the trophy on the last matchday. Schalke has been relegated, Stuttgart has to go into the relegation. Union Berlin qualifies for the Champions League. Freiburg and Leverkusen finished fifth and sixth, and Frankfurt also qualified for the European Cup. In the cup final next week, it will be decided whether for the Europa League or Conference League.

Matchday 34 of the Bundesliga

Dortmund – Mainz2:2 (0:2)
RB Leipzig – Schalke4:2 (2:1)
Union Berlin – Bremen1:0 (0:0)
Cologne – FC Bayern1:2 (0:1)
Gladbach – Augsburg2:0 (1:0)
Frankfurt – Freiburg2:1 (0:0)
Wolfsburg – Hertha1:2 (1:0)
Bochum – Leverkusen3:0 (2:0)
Stuttgart – Hoffenheim1:1 (0:0)

Update from May 27, 15:20 p.m.: A stray swarm of bees has made it difficult to broadcast Sky in Dortmund before the big championship final of the Bundesliga. Dietmar Hamann, Erik Meijer and presenter Michael Leopold were violently buzzed around in preparation about 45 minutes before the start of the game and even had to interrupt their panel of experts. Even a camera was no longer usable.

The swarm had largely settled on a TV spotlight, which two brave firefighters finally carried out of the interior. It didn't get much better at first. The visit was fitting: BVB's mascot is the bee "Emma".

Update from May 27, 15:05 p.m.: Before the BVB match against Mainz, there was a power outage in Dortmund. Ironically, the power went out at the "Signal-Iduna-Park" stop. The fans were diverted via the main train station. The arrival of the stadium visitors was delayed accordingly.

Preliminary report: Munich – On Saturday afternoon (kick-off at 15.30 CET), the last and 34th matchday of the Bundesliga is on the agenda. The championship is more exciting than it has been for a long time. Borussia Dortmund go into the long-distance duel with FC Bayern Munich with a two-point lead. And also in the fight for Europe and against relegation, the decisions could literally be made at the last minute.

Klopp interferes in title race between BVB and FC Bayern

BVB are very close to their big goal of becoming German champions for the first time since 2012. Should Borussia win the home game against Mainz at Signal Iduna Park, the trophy is safe. In the event of a blunder, however, FC Bayern could still pass with a win in Cologne.

Thomas Müller has already made himself unpopular with a nasty trick before the championship final and is building up maximum pressure on BVB. He had read that the whole city, "I think 200,000 to 400,000 fans would be expected at a championship celebration. I'll put it this way: To meet the expectations of so many people, you have to get that right with a wide cross on the pitch. If the whole Dortmund South wants to win, you have to withstand it as a player." Even ex-BVB coach Jürgen Klopp is getting involved in the title race and is "a bit nervous".

Bundesliga conference in the live ticker: Will BVB be German champions, who will be relegated?

The Mainz team could tip the scales in the championship race. The Rheinhessen defeated the Bavarians a few weeks ago. Will they be able to do the same against BVB this time? However, FSV have to play away in Dortmund. Ex-Mainz coach Thomas Tuchel is hoping for help.

But the battle for Europe also promises pure excitement. Union Berlin (against Bremen) and Freiburg (in Frankfurt) are level on points and are fighting for the last place in the Champions League. Leverkusen (in Bochum) and Wolfsburg (against relegated Hertha) are dueling for sixth place, while the Werkself are in a better position with a one-point lead. With a three-point deficit, Eintracht Frankfurt only has outsider chances.

Relegation thriller: Four teams fight to stay in the league

In the relegation battle, a heart-stopping final awaits the fans. Augsburg (34 points) has the best chance of staying in the league in 14th place, followed by Stuttgart (32), Bochum (32) and Schalke (31). Hertha BSC was relegated at the last minute last week.
